Kindergarten Students Sign 'Happy Birthday' Song For Deaf Custodian
October 25, 2018
An entire class of kindergarten students in Tullahoma, Tennessee, surprised their custodian by signing "Happy Birthday" to him on his birthday.
James Anthony, who's deaf, immediately brought his hands to his head in disbelief.
"Our Kindergarten classes learned how to sign Happy Birthday for Mr. James' birthday today. He was so surprised!" the school wrote on Facebook.
According to Principal Jimmy Anderson, Mr. James is loved by all the students.
"Mr. James teaches the kids sign language every now and then, teaches them good manners and how to treat other people," Anderson said.
